Charleston is known for its historical culture and the city is a popular tourist destination. While the tourism and service industries contribute much in the way of jobs to residents, the medical and technological industries are growing at a steady pace in Charleston. The city is an interesting blend of old and new. The low country is full of rich, historical charm, while the metropolitan area maintains itself on the cutting edge of business and medical innovation. Charleston is also home to a diverse group of manufacturers and this helps South Carolina rank as the fifth most industrial state in America. The United States Navy remains the largest employer to the residents of Charleston.
